Preview
Flamengo and Fluminense meet at Estadio Jornalista Mário Filho, in a 2nd leg match for the Carioca 1 (Championship ‑ Semi‑finals). Flamengo got an away win by (0‑2) in the previous 1st leg match. The head‑to‑head history at this stadium, favours the home team, since in the last 23 head‑to‑heads they won 11, tied 7 and lost 5. Accordingly, in the last head‑to‑head played at this stadium, for the Carioca 1, on 10‑03‑2024, Flamengo won by (0‑2). Pedro (90' ) and Everton (45' ) scored the goals of the match for Flamengo. Fluminense registers significant differences between home and away results, so special attention is due to the home/away factor.

Analysis Flamengo

This is a team that usually maintains its competitive level in home and away matches, since in the last 30 matches they register 7 wins, 6 draws and 2 losses in away matches, with 22 goals scored and 8 conceded; against 11 wins, 1 draw and 3 losses at their stadium, with 27 goals scored and 8 conceded. Flamengo registers 6 wins in the last 6 home matches for the Carioca 1.

They have won the last 6 home matches and haven't lost any of the last 12 matches for this competition. Defensive consistency has been one of their best features, as they haven’t conceded any goals in the last 10 matches, and their offense has scored consistently, as they have scored goals in 8 of the last 10 matches for this competition. This is a team that likes to score first. They have opened up the score in 9 of the last 12 matches for the Carioca 1, they have reached half‑time in front in 7 of those 9 matches and have always held on to the lead until the end of the 90'. In the last 20 home matches for all competitions there is 1 period that stands out: they have conceded 5 of their 12 goals between minutes (76'‑90').

The Flamengo wants to start the year with the Rio de Janeiro state championship title, and in this semifinal, the team managed to open up a significant advantage, making the spot in the final very close. The team, champions of the Taça Guanabara undefeated and conceding only one goal, arrives with the status of the best team in the country currently, given the results they have been achieving under the command of coach Tite and also due to the quality of the squad. In the first leg of the tie, the convincing victory by (0-2) showed that Flamengo is indeed the favorite for the title of the competition, and in this match, the expectation is that the team will secure another victory.

Analysis Fluminense

This is a team that usually makes good use of the home advantage, stronger with the help of its supporters, since in the last 30 matches they register 3 wins, 5 draws and 7 losses in away matches, with 10 goals scored and 17 conceded; against 9 wins, 2 draws and 4 losses at their stadium, with 29 goals scored and 20 conceded. In the last 5 Carioca 1 away matches Fluminense has a record of 2 wins, 2 draws and 1 loss. Their offense has scored consistently, as they have scored goals in 7 of the last 10 matches for this competition. In 12 matches for this competition, they have conceded the first goal 4 times and have only turned the score around in 1. In the last 20 away matches for all competitions there is 1 period that stands out: they have scored 7 of their 19 goals between minutes (76'‑90').

Fluminense needs to put on a great performance to have a chance of qualifying for the final of the championship. The team lost the first leg by (0-2) and needs to win by at least three goals to secure qualification for the final, as Flamengo holds the advantage of a draw. This is a match where Fluminense cannot afford any mistakes, as a goal from the opponent could definitively decide the spot. With little attacking presence in the previous match, Fluminense needs to adopt an efficient strategy aiming to effectively attack Flamengo, score goals, and achieve a heroic qualification for the grand final.
